As of February 2026, the mindshare of LEAPWORK in the Test Automation Tools category stands at 1.6%, up from 1.4% compared to the previous year, according to calculations based on PeerSpot user engagement data.

Test Associate & Manager at IGT Solutions3.5As partners with LEAPWORK, we use it for end-to-end automation of server and web-based applications. Its user-friendly, low-code/no-code interface and deployment options offer a good ROI, although initial key management could be improved.
